Publicity Assistant – Entertainment
Talent
We are currently working with a fantastic PR agency, who are keen on staying ahead of the curve when it comes to looking after their top tier talent. With a roster of talent spanning across Television, Lifestyle, Music, Radio, Podcasts and Books and more, this is an opportunity not to be missed!
This role is for a Publicity Assistant to focus on the talent PR support as well as other PR duties within the agency. This candidate must be super eager, fascinated by the world of entertainment and highly driven for progression. If you are a recent graduate with a passion for entertainment and PR or someone who is ready to kick start their career in publicity, then this could be the perfect role.
Key responsibilities
- Staying up to date with coverage emails
- Help create call sheets for talent photoshoots
- Liaise with clients and managers to organize interviews and photoshoots
- Assist publicists at photo shoots and interviews
- Look out and spot potential new talent!
- Monitor coverage for your teams clients
- Flagging any press that could be of concern to clients publicist
- Send daily coverage emails to clients
- Keep an eye on the media
- Create media lists for specific client announcements
- Compile and send campaign reports to clients
- Help publicists find relevant contacts
- Work closely with the social media team to ensure client coverage moments are posted on socials
- Keep across teams to ensure clients feel equally represented on their socials
You will have:
- excellent grammar and spelling
- A confident and enthusiastic mindset
- The ability to work in a fast paced environment
- Enthusiasm towards the world of entertainment
